About Kaziranga National Park
Kaziranga National Park is one of India’s oldest and most celebrated wildlife reserves located in the heart of Assam between the mighty Brahmaputra River and the lush Karbi Anglong Hills Declared a UNESCO World Heritage Site in 1985 Kaziranga is globally known for sheltering two-thirds of the world’s population of the great one-horned rhinoceros The park spans across nearly 430 square kilometers and is divided into distinct ranges each with its own beauty and wildlife Kaziranga is also home to tigers elephants wild water buffaloes swamp deer leopards and a wide variety of birds including pelicans hornbills and storks It is one of the few national parks in India where you can experience grasslands wetlands and dense forests all within a single landscape The park’s ecosystem is supported by the annual floods of the Brahmaputra River which replenish its soil and sustain its rich biodiversity

Wildlife Safari Experience
The true essence of Kaziranga lies in its thrilling jungle safaris The park offers both jeep and elephant safaris allowing you to explore its diverse zones The Central Range Kohora is popular among first-time visitors for its balanced wildlife sightings The Western Range Bagori is known for rhino and buffalo sightings while the Eastern Range Agaratoli offers dense forests and abundant birdlife The Burapahar Range provides a quieter and more offbeat experience Elephant safaris are ideal for close encounters with rhinos in the early morning mist while jeep safaris let you explore deep into the forest covering larger areas The safaris are conducted by experienced naturalists and forest guards ensuring both safety and education The best time to enjoy safaris is between November and April when the park remains open and visibility is excellent

Attractions Around Kaziranga
While Kaziranga is known for its wildlife the region also offers numerous nearby attractions that add more color to your trip The Kaziranga National Orchid and Biodiversity Park is home to over 500 species of orchids and showcases Assam’s native flora and cultural heritage The Kakochang Waterfalls located about 14 kilometers from Bokakhat offer a refreshing escape amid natural beauty For those interested in culture nearby villages like Japoripothar and Hathikuli provide authentic glimpses of Assamese life You can witness traditional weaving bamboo craft and taste local delicacies made from rice and herbs Tea garden visits are also a must as Assam is known worldwide for its tea You can stroll through the estates meet local workers and even taste freshly brewed tea right at the source

Best Time to Visit
Kaziranga National Park welcomes visitors from November to April This period offers the best conditions for wildlife viewing and outdoor activities Winter months from November to February are ideal for those who enjoy cool weather and misty mornings perfect for elephant safaris The months of March and April bring warmer temperatures blooming flora and frequent animal sightings During the monsoon from May to October the park remains closed as the Brahmaputra floods large parts of Kaziranga However the surrounding landscapes remain lush and picturesque making the off-season ideal for tea estate visits and cultural tours

Cultural Experience
A trip to Kaziranga is incomplete without experiencing the vibrant culture of Assam  The local people are warm welcoming and proud of their traditions Visitors can witness traditional Bihu dance performances colorful folk music and try authentic Assamese dishes such as fish tenga bamboo shoot curry and pitha sweet rice cakes Art lovers can explore local handloom centers where artisans weave beautiful muga silk and cotton fabrics on traditional looms Village visits offer opportunities to learn about rural life farming practices and the connection between people and nature Shopping for souvenirs like bamboo crafts and handmade jewelry is also a great way to support local artisans
